Metrics, Accessibility, Localization, Community

  • Community
    • Community helped with flash crash issue: We sent out calls fro help via QMO (1, 2), irc, and Facebook. Several people responded!
    • Held a Test Day last Friday on New features for 3.6
    • Next Open Source meet-up in Munich on Friday, September 25. Tell your German Friends!
    • Next community meet-up is on Wednesday, Sept, 23. Topic is Feature Exploration/Live Testing.
    • Prague Dev day is Friday, October 2nd. Members of the QA team will be talking about testing projects and how to get involved.
    • Detected that users on Ubuntu with an official release/nightly build from Mozilla are not able to send Crash reports due to use of a non-default installed libcurl library bug 517493

Developer Tools

  • Ben and Joe were at The Ajax Experience
  • Firefox Platform summit was on Friday
  • Bespin 0.4.4 "Bubba Ho-Tep" was released (bugfixes)

This week:

  • Live file history - initial release of this feature planned for this week.
  • Bespin "Reboot" planning (next week, we're on site to work through a structural overhaul of Bespin's code)
  • Plugin loading/infrastructure for Bespin Reboot
  • Set up new Bespin hg repositories that will be a home for the Reboot code. Will also be breaking the server and client into separate repos.
